Thursday January 17, 2013 is national “Thank Your Mentor Day”
This is a wonderful opportunity for teams to give their mentors special thanks and to publicize the important work the mentors do.
Remember the technical and the non-technical mentors, such as the engineers, machinists, teachers, parents, college students and other adults who may help your team.
Tell your community how important your mentors are to your team.
There were 100,000+ mentors and volunteers involved in FIRST programs last year. We have a lot to be thankful for!
Some ideas:
• Contact your local media [newspaper, TV station, and social media] for a story about your mentors and your team.
• Recognize your mentors at your school during morning announcements.
• Send an e-card through www.whomentoredyou.org or other sites.
• Organize an open house for the team’s community, with special recognition highlighting the mentors.
• Write a thank you note. Include a picture of the team.
